DefinePK

DefinePK hosts the largest index of Pakistani journals, research articles, news headlines, and videos. It also offers chapter-level book search.

Flask Weather Wizadry: Create a Robust App with Advanced Features and User-friendly, Mastering the Art of Forecasting


Article Information

Title: Flask Weather Wizadry: Create a Robust App with Advanced Features and User-friendly, Mastering the Art of Forecasting

Authors: K.E. Kannammal, Arcchana V

Journal: Journal of Neonatal Surgery

HEC Recognition History
Category From To
Y 2023-07-01 2024-09-30
Y 2022-07-01 2023-06-30

Publisher: EL-MED-Pub Publishers

Country: Pakistan

Year: 2025

Volume: 14

Issue: 31S

Language: en

Keywords: Web Development

Categories

Abstract

This study suggests the creation of a weather forecasting app based on Flask, a Python web application framework, with the addition of IBM Watson API for precise meteorological information. The project aims to create an easy-to-use platform that integrates several web development technologies, such as SQLAlchemy for database management and Flask-Login for secure authentication and authorizing. Front-end functionalities, developed using Bootstrap, JavaScript, and AJAX, include responsive design and dynamic content. Our strategy involves strict validation, safe user input handling, and strong integration with weather data sources using IBM Watson API to provide data accuracy and application reliability. Thorough testing and debugging procedures also guarantee the user experience via greater reliability. Findings indicate that applying Flask in conjunction with IBM Watson API presents a reliable solution for real-time weather forecasting, which is accurate and scalable. The current work introduces to the literature a systematic process that can be adopted by developers to create interactive and secure web applications with Flask and third-party APIs, and provides useful guidelines to new as well as experienced web developers.


Paper summary is not available for this article yet.

Loading PDF...

Loading Statistics...